Abstract

Quality is the most important element in the process of production or services produced by organization to its customers. Quality of service refers to the measure of how a service is delivered matches customer expectations. The study aims to examine the quality of public health services received by immigrant labours. There are three aspects of quality in public health services to be measured i.e health service condition, the waiting time for treatment and treatment by hospital staff on immigrant labours.
